Job Description:

Babbel is hiring a talented Motion Graphics Designer / Videographer who thrives in a self-directed environment to join the hard-working, fast-paced, creatively-driven Video team. The ideal candidate will bring strong design and typographic sensibilities, animation expertise, and a comprehensive understanding of content production workflows- including the ability to shoot and edit videos. You will play a pivotal role in bringing our creative vision to life through various video and animation projects. You will be responsible for overseeing the end-to-end process of video production, from conceptualization to execution and delivery. Hands-on experience in social content creation or self-produced projects is a big plus.
